Why has a huge company like Google still not created a real system automation tool like Apple Shortcuts on iPhone?
Yes, Android has third-party apps like Tasker, MacroDroid, and others. But that is not the same. I mean a native, simple, and secure solution built directly into the system.
On iPhone, with Shortcuts, you can easily:
— turn off mobile data automatically when you arrive home
— change wallpapers depending on location (home / work)
— create actions for third-party apps
— automate message sending
— set actions for charging,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and more
And even more serious scenarios:
Phone stolen?
Automatically take a photo with the front camera and send it to a selected contact with location.
